• ベストアンサー

エクセルの計算式(振り分け)

お世話になります。 エクセルの計算式で教えていただきたいです。 1~100の整数を縦軸に手入力して横軸のセル 10未満 10以上20未満 20以上30未満 30以上40未満 40以上50未満 50以上60未満 60以上70未満 70以上80未満 80以上90未満 90以上100未満 に振り分けるにはどのような数式がでしょうか? できればIF文以外でお願いします。

質問者が選んだベストアンサー

  • ベストアンサー
回答No.1

IF文ではなくIF関数を使って B2セルに =IF(AND($A2<>"",(COLUMN(A1)-1)*10<=$A2,$A2<COLUMN(A1)*10),$A2,"") 右へ下へオートフィル

GUWANA
質問者

お礼

ありがとうございました。 この数式が一番しっくり来ます。

全文を見る
すると、全ての回答が全文表示されます。

その他の回答 (2)

回答No.3

#1です IF関数を使わずにもう一案 空白処理はセルの書式設定で行うとして (表示形式 - ユーザー定義 #) B1セル 10 C1セル 20 B1:C1セルを右へオートフィル B1:K1セルを選択して =TRANSPOSE(FREQUENCY(A2,B$1:K$1))*$A2 [Ctrl]+[Shift] +[Enter] で確定、配列数式です({}で囲まれる) B1:K1セルを下へオートフィル 添付図参照 参考まで

GUWANA
質問者

お礼

ありがとうございました。 勉強になります。

全文を見る
すると、全ての回答が全文表示されます。
  • tom04
  • ベストアンサー率49% (2537/5117)
回答No.2

こんばんは! 色々方法はあるかと思いますが・・・ 一例です。 ↓の画像で説明させていただきます。 実際のデータとしては2行目(未満の行)は必要ないのですが、 理解しやすいと思い表示させています。 尚、質問には100以上の場合がないので、 余計なお世話かも知れませんが、100以上の列も作ってみました。 表のB3セルに =IF($A3="","",IF(COLUMN(A1)=MATCH($A3,$B$1:$L$1,1),$A3,"")) という数式を入れて、オートフィルで列・行方向にコピーすると 画像のような感じになります。 以上、参考になれば幸いですが、 他に良い方法があれば読み流してくださいね。m(__)m

GUWANA
質問者

お礼

ありがとうございました。 10未満でエラーなりました。

全文を見る
すると、全ての回答が全文表示されます。

関連するQ&A

  • エクセル2000の計算式について

    エクセル2000の計算式について A1に入力する値が、5000未満の時→B1セルに、0 が A1に入力する値が、5000以上10000未満の時→B1セルに、500 が A1に入力する値が、10000以上15000未満の時→B1セルに、1000 が A1に入力する値が、15000以上20000未満の時→B1セルに、1500 が A1に入力する値が、20000以上25000未満の時→B1セルに、2000 が 表記されるような、B1セルの「計算式」を教えていただけませんか? 「IF関数」を組み合わせる事で解決するのでしょうか? 関数の組み合わせ方法が、解りません…

  • エクセルで時間計算

    エクセルで時間計算をしているのですが A1セルに開始時刻  B1セルに終了時刻  C1セルは作業時間   9:00         4:00           7:00 このような表を作っています 「C1」には(B1+12:00)マイナス「A1」と数式があるのですが 「B1」に入る時刻が午後でなく午前11:00だと 「C1」の数式のままでは (11:00+12:00)- 9:00 で 14:00 となってしまいます 「B1」には24時間形式で午後4:00を16:00と入力すればよいのですが 24時間形式を使わず9:00マイナス4:00を正しく計算するには どのような数式にすればよいのでしょうか IF文を使うのかなとも思うのですが 見当がつきません。宜しくお願いいたします。

  • EXCELで経過時間計算および作図

    実験データをEXCELで計算させ、結果を作図する場合なのですが、 (1)経過時間計算:入力として測定した時間をセルの書式指定で「日付、2006/6/2 16:20」と言った形式を指定したセルに入力し、経過時間を引き算し、その結果をセルの書式指定「時刻 13:30」とすると、経過時間が24時間以内であれば良いのですが、それ以上の時間では24進法で区切られてしまいます。25:00とか100:00時間と言った経過時間を表示させるのはどうしたらよいでしょうか? (2)作図:経過時間を横軸にして、結果を縦軸として作図したところ、横軸がやっぱり24進法で区切られます。これも25:00とか100:00時間と言った経過時間を表示させるのはどうしたらよいでしょうか?

  • EXCEL計算式が入っているセルを空白表示に

    EXCELデータで、セルに計算式が入っているのに画面上には何も数字が表示されていないというファイルをもらいました。 普通に、例えばSUM関数とかを入力したとき、結果が0だと、0が表示されますよね。もらったファイルでは、0が表示されておらず、0以外だと表示されるようになっています。 そのセルの計算式を見ても、特に変わった条件数式(IF関数など)が入ってもおらず、セルの書式設定を見ても特に変わったことがあるようには思えませんでした。 いったいどうやったら、こういうことができるのでしょうか?

  • エクセルの計算式を教えてください。

    エクセルの計算式を教えてください。 例えば、セルB2に、IF(B1="","",20)という数式があったとしまして、B2が "" だった場合、別セルに =B2+50 という計算式を入れると、B2を空白とみなさず、VALUE!になってしまいますが、この空白のB2を、0もしくは、無視して計算する方法はありますでしょうか?

  • エクセルが計算をしない。

    見積をエクセルの数式を使用して作成しています。 単価*数量の数式で金額が算出できるようにセル内に数式を入力した見積のフォーマットを作成し、しばらく正常に計算出来ていたのですがある日を境に単価と数量を入力しても計算を行わなくなりました。 どのような原因が考えられるのでしょうか?

  • エクセル2000で計算式をいれたセルに文字を打つ時

    いつもいつも、お世話になっています。 エクセルで数式を入れたセルに文字を打つと数式がDeleteされてしまいます。 数式だけ保護する方法ってないですか? 作った数式はVLOOKUP関数です。 A1のセルに番号をいれるとB1のセルに患者名がでるように設定しました。 B1に患者名を直接入力すると計算式は消えてしまいますよね。。 B1に直接入力しても数式は残せる方法ってありますか?

  • Excelの時間計算(引き算)の端数処理について教えて下さい。

    Excelの時間計算(引き算)の端数処理について教えて下さい。 以下Excelの内容です  セルA1:22:00  セルA2:22:30  セルA3:=A2-A1   ※表示形式は"[h]:mm"です。 上記の場合、A3は「0:30」となると思います。 ここまでは良いと思いますが、同じ表示形式でセルA4に「0:30」と手入力し、 セルA3とセルA4をif文で比較すると、一致しない結果となってしまいます。 セルA5:=if(A3=A4,TRUE,FALSE) ⇒結果はFALSE 数式の検証で確認したところ、  セルA3=0.0208333...334  セルA4=0.0208333...333 と、確かに小数点第16位が異なっています。 もっと追いかけるとセルA2の「22:30」に端数が発生しており、整数のセルA1と無限小数のセルA2を引き算を行ったため、丸め誤差によりこのような現象となっているようです。 時間の引き算を行う場合は、時分秒毎に計算し直さなければならないのでしょうか? または、TEXTで変換やtimevalu等を利用する等の回避策は有るのでしょうか? 時間計算を行う際の鉄則などありましたら、ご教授頂ければと思います。 皆様のお知恵をおかしくださいm(_ _)m

  • Excel での計算

    EXcelを初めて使用する初心者です。 Excelを使用し、次のような式を計算する場合、「数式バー」に入力すれば計算出来ることは、承知しているのですが、「セル」に入力し保存、必要な時に数式の一部だけを変更し計算する事は出来ますか?            ( A-( B÷C ×D + E + F +G ))  上式で、A,B,C,E,F,Gは定数(変更しない数値)で、Dを毎回変更するということが出来ますか?(そもそも「セル」に入力出来ますか?)

  • Excelで計算式が正しく入らないのですが。

    Excelで計算式の入ったセルをコピーし別のセルに貼り付けると、計算式ではなくもとのセルの値が張り付きます。数式バーには計算式が入っているのですが・・・また、数式バーの最後にカーセルを合わせ、Enterを押すと正しい値に変わります。

このQ&Aのポイント
  • ADS-3600Wを使用している際、紙詰まりが頻繁に発生して困っている方へ、解決方法をご紹介します。
  • 厚紙や上質紙をスキャンする際に問題が発生している場合、ローラーの清掃や給紙時の抑えの調整を行うことが有効です。
  • また、MacOSを使用しており、USBケーブルでの接続を選んでいる方は、無線接続に切り替えることで回線の途切れを解消できます。
回答を見る

専門家に質問してみよう